We all recognize that a strong culture of trust is essential for any team to maximize its impact and success. When trust is present, people feel valued, fulfilled, and motivated—and they stay longer. Yet despite knowing its importance, trust often remains difficult to build, challenging to sustain, and even harder to repair when it falters.

Trust can feel abstract or intangible, but it doesn’t have to be. In this team session, we break trust down into a clear, practical framework with four key components. This framework offers a concrete way to reflect on how trust is built—and how it erodes—so leaders can take intentional action rather than relying on guesswork or hope.

By exploring each component and practicing specific moves to ensure these elements of trust are alive on our teams, you will gain insight into what you already do well and where you can grow. You’ll leave with a deeper understanding of how trust shows up in everyday interactions and with tools you can use immediately to strengthen trust across your team.

This session blends research-based content with role plays, discussion, and practical application. Participants will walk away with strategies they can implement the very next day—and a mindset that will support them throughout their careers as they build and maintain healthy, thriving teams.
